Chicago Bears QB Caleb Williams pokes at Packers

Like in Week 14, the Chicago Bears are getting set to play the Green Bay Packers with the first place in the NFC North hanging in the balance.

The 10-4 Bears were able to take back the lead in the division by beating the Cleveland Browns 31-3 on Sunday. The Packers suffered a few big things in a 34-26 loss to the Denver Broncos in Week 15.

Star pass-rusher Micah Parsons has been lost for the season after tearing his ACL while trying to pressure Bo Nix. Green Bay had the lead when Parsons exited in the third quarter. Things went sideways quickly for the Packers without him.

During his news conference on Tuesday, Bears quarterback Caleb Williams poked at the Packers a little before Saturday night’s game at Soldier Field.

Williams suggested Chicago should have won its Week 14 matchup before letting Green Bay escape with a 28-21 win at Lambeau Field.

“I am excited for it,” Williams said of playing the Packers in primetime, via CHGO Bears. “I think everybody is excited for it. We feel like we let them off the hook. We want to go out there and play our brand of football. We are excited to go showcase that.”

Williams and the Bears offense struggled to play efficiently in the first half in Week 14, trailing Green Bay 14-3 at the half. Williams finished with 186 yards passing and two interceptions, but he threw an interception on the final drive that decided the outcome.

Green Bay’s defense should look different in Saturday night’s game. However, Bears head coach Ben Johnson understands that can cause challenges for the offense.

“They are changing,” Johnson said of the Packers. “Micah is out. We gotta be prepared to adjust and plan accordingly.”

Even with Parsons out, the Bears are a 1.5-point underdog, per ESPN BET.
